Executive Summary: Hydrogen Economy Market Outlook 2025

  • Industry Growth Overview: The hydrogen market will grow from USD 22.38 billion in 2025 to USD 40.39 billion in 2029, at a compound annual growth rate of 15.9%. On a micro level, the hydrogen economy is growing at a 4.02% annual growth rate as per the Discovery Platform’s latest data.
  • Manpower & Employment Growth: The market employs more than 1.4 million professionals worldwide, and it added 68 100+ new employees in the last year.
  • Patents & Grants: With more than 2.25 million patents and 3470 grants, innovation continues to be at the core of the hydrogen economy. Although, the power sector experienced a 43% decline in hydrogen-related patent applications in Q2 2024.
  • Global Footprint: Major hubs include the US, UK, India, Germany, and China, while cities like London, Houston, Melbourne, Singapore and Sydney drive regional innovation.
  • Investment Landscape: The sector has had significant capital infusion, supporting expansion in production, storage, and fuel cell technologies, with major investors contributing a total of about USD 24.3 billion. There has been a seven-fold increase in investments for hydrogen projects reaching final investment decisions (FID), growing from 102 projects worth USD 10 billion in 2020 to 434 projects worth USD 75 billion in 2024.
  • Top Investors: Leading investors such as the European Investment Bank, Japan Bank for International Cooperation, Société Générale, and more have invested around USD 24.3 billion.
  • Startup Ecosystem: Five innovative startups, Green Hydrogen Technology (waste-to-hydrogen conversion), DeCarice (fleet decarbonization), FLEXERGY (hydrogen compression), HYDROLYX (sustainable hydrogen production), and TERRABARRIER (hydrogen permeation solutions), showcase the sector’s global reach and entrepreneurial spirit.

According to The Business Research Company, the hydrogen market will grow from USD 22.38 billion in 2025 to USD 40.39 billion in 2029, at a compound annual growth rate of 15.9%.

With a database of more than 11 600 companies overall and more than 840 startups, the market shows a vibrant entrepreneurial ecosystem.

Last year, the hydrogen economy market grew by 4.02%, highlighting a stable and continuous expansion.

As per the Hydrogen Council, the total announced investments in clean hydrogen projects are expected to rise to about USD 680 billion by 2030.

 

 

More than 2.25 million patents and 3470+ grants supporting technological breakthroughs show the market’s high level of R&D activity. The industry employs more than 1.4 million employees worldwide, and in the last year alone, there have been 68 100+ increase in manpower.

Top country hubs such as the US, UK, India, Germany, and China serve as the geographic anchors of the hydrogen economy, while major city hubs like London, Houston, Melbourne, Sydney, and Singapore are essential for promoting innovation and uptake.

The US hydrogen generation market was valued at USD 40.3 billion in 2024, with projections to reach USD 56.8 billion by 2033, reflecting a CAGR of 3.9% from 2025 to 2033.

According to IGEM’s news report, the UK government announced around USD 2.44 billion in investment in 11 green hydrogen projects across the country in 2024.

A Snapshot of the Global Hydrogen Economy Market

With a 4.02% yearly growth rate, the market is still growing rapidly due to a strong entrepreneurial ecosystem that includes more than 840 startups. More than 570 startups are in the early stages, indicating a pipeline of fresh ideas and new competitors.

As per Research and Markets, the global hydrogen market was projected to reach 101.97 million tons in 2024, with anticipated growth to 135.31 million tons by 2032, reflecting a compound annual growth rate of 3.6%.

 

 

With more than 760 recorded mergers and acquisitions (M&A), the sector also shows a high level of consolidation activity.

As demonstrated by its 2 251 500+ patents and 2 34 600+ applicants, which show substantial R&D efforts, innovation is at the core of the hydrogen economy. However, annual patent growth has decreased by -0.95%, indicating that innovation pace needs to be maintained.

The worldwide competition for technological leadership in this field is highlighted by the fact that the US leads the world in patent issuance with 462 890+ patents, closely followed by China with 336 140+ patents.

Adding to this, H2Terminals Limited partnered with China National Energy Group’s subsidiary, Longyuan Environmental Protection Co. Ltd., and Yangzhou Pingbuqingyun Hydrogen Tech Ltd. to develop three major green hydrogen projects in China.

Overview of Hydrogen Economy Trends

 

  • Hydrogen Production is expanding due to the increased need for renewable energy alternatives. This trend shows a high employment increase, with 1100+ startups employing over 84 400 employees, including 7200 recruits in the past year. The domain’s critical role in expanding hydrogen technology to fulfill global energy needs is highlighted by its annual growth rate of 20.39%. As per IEA’s report, based on announced projects, low-emissions hydrogen could reach 49 million tonnes per annum by 2030.
  • Hydrogen Storage is essential for facilitating efficient energy distribution and consumption and it is continuously improving. 35 100+ employees are employed by 490+ startups in this segment, and 2400 new employment were generated in the last 12 months. Its 5.37% annual growth rate reflects rising investments and advancements in storage technologies.
  • Hydrogen Fuel Cell Technologies provide clean power generation and mobility. This trend, which employs 147 800 employees across 1260+ companies, added 9900 new employees in the previous year. The domain’s widespread adoption indicates a strong and developed market for fuel cell solutions despite its slight annual trend growth rate of 1.97%. Moreover, as per Research And Markets, the hydrogen fuel cell vehicle market is valued at USD 8.31 billion in 2025 and is expected to grow at a CAGR of 19.78% over the forecast period to reach USD 20.49 billion in 2030.

Further, the global green hydrogen market was valued at approximately USD 7.98 billion in 2024 and is projected to grow at a CAGR of 38.5% from 2025 to 2030.

Spain’s second-largest oil company will start building a green hydrogen plant in Huelva this year, targeting 2 GW by 2030, with 400 MW online by 2027.

Green Hydrogen Technology converts Waste to Hydrogen

German startup Green Hydrogen Technology creates climate-neutral hydrogen from non-recyclable plastic waste using its technology.

It provides an environmentally friendly substitute by converting resources like plastic, wood waste, and sewage sludge into high-purity hydrogen without releasing CO₂.

 

 

The startup lowers expenses and environmental effects by enabling decentralized hydrogen generation which does not require substantial transportation infrastructure.

This further encourages the use of renewable energy by enabling businesses, utilities, and municipalities to manufacture hydrogen locally for industrial uses.

Additionally, Green Hydrogen Technology offers a scalable option for a circular economy while solving dual problems of waste management and the need for clean energy.

DeCarice enables Fleet Decarbonisation

Australian startup DeCarice creates a retrofit hydrogen-diesel system that aids in fleet decarbonization by adapting existing engines to operate with hydrogen fuel.

The technology combines dual-fuel direct injection to produce a hydrogen-diesel blend by integrating hydrogen gas injectors with existing diesel systems.

This method lowers carbon emissions as up to 90% hydrogen is used in place of diesel which offers environmental advantage without decreasing vehicle performance.

Additionally, the system eases conversion between diesel and hydrogen modes, giving heavy-duty fleets operational flexibility.

DeCarice’s retrofit solution provides a cost-effective decarbonization method for businesses that depend on diesel-powered machinery..

TERRABARRIER offers Hydrogen Permeation and Embrittlement

Swedish startup TERRABARRIER creates a coating technology to solve embrittlement and hydrogen penetration in critical infrastructure.

It makes storage tanks, pipelines, and other hydrogen systems more resilient and long-lasting through its coatings, which create thick barriers that shield objects exposed to hydrogen.
